Soon, Yate, who observed through the phantom's senses, discovered that the malice was rapidly condensing.
Similarly, through his own essence as a concept of doom, Yago can still feel the fluctuation of the power of the fate-related rules there, even if he restrains his perception as much as possible.
But it was also this that made him feel something was wrong.
He had already confirmed it before.
The fate of this world, whether it is luck or bad luck, is locked and written to death.
From the moment a person is born, if he does not suffer from the interference of forces outside the world, the bonus of disaster and luck he suffers is constant within a certain range.
If a person's luck is constant at 7, then the most lucky event he can encounter is 7, and he will not encounter disasters above 7 degrees for most of his life.
In the previous world, the "total value that can be added and subtracted" was calculated based on consumption.
For example, if a person's total value is 70, he encounters a lucky event of 7, consumes 7 points, and leaves 63, then the number of lucky events he may encounter above level 7 will be reduced.
At the same time, if he encounters a huge calamity, such as level 7, he will add 7 points to 70.
The luckier a person is and the less unlucky things happen, the faster the person will die.
Once the total value is exhausted, the person's luck will completely disappear, and it's time to exit.
At this time, even if you just fall, you will die.
And this world is not.
The luck and bad luck of this world is constant, there is no so-called "total value", and it is not the general existence of "consumables" in the previous world.
In this world, people with a level 7 destiny would only encounter luck or calamity events of up to level 7 or so under normal circumstances.
That is to say, in this case, these people themselves will not even show up in the larger event.
As for whether they will die?
Judging from what Yate has observed so far, it is not certain.
From this perspective, Art believes that the world does not have a "constant" fate.
Not to say destiny force.
As far as he understands, the power of fate is based on a regular corridor connected to the long river of time or a similar regular polymer, and the fate-like power that is opposite to the corresponding person or object is placed in it.
Because the power of fate in the corridor of rules resonates with the power of fate of the corresponding characters and objects to manipulate the changes in the world.
Outside the corridors of rules, in the "world", the power of fate in the characters will be connected with the long river of time due to the influence and influence of props such as fate slates in the corridors of rules.
Under this mechanism, if the fate of the characters deviates, it will affect the long river of time, so that they can draw strength from the ebb and flow of the long river of time.
However, each change can only absorb power once.
Because it is involved with the long river of time, when it causes changes in the long river of time, the power of the long river of time will also reversely act on the corresponding characters and events in the world, forming a new stable trend again.
If you want to draw strength again, you need to deviate from fate again.
In this case, it is necessary that the luck and bad luck of people and corresponding objects can flow.
Otherwise, under the traction of the long river of time, the world will suffer shocks.
This is also the reason why Art is skeptical about this world.
The luck and misfortune of this world are always on the characters and objects.
In this form, because the power is fixed and cannot flow, then, if it resonates with the long river of time, then the pressure brought by the long river of time is extremely huge.
If you want to change your destiny, you need extremely huge power.
Two worlds of the same level, under different rules, changing the fate of a low-level character whose fate cannot be changed will consume even more than that of a high-level character whose fate can flow.
However, this is also two-sided.
Because fate is locked and cannot flow.
Therefore, once a lock is destroyed, the power of fate on it will crush other locks under the urging of time, forming a chain reaction of collapse.
In order to prevent this situation, the means is precise control.
Although the shapes are different, this setting is also to draw strength from the long river of time.
Although the lock is broken, it will cause a big collapse, but in this case, it is good to keep the lock and place a limited amount of destiny power.
The general trend of fate remains unchanged, but there will be many small changes and derivatives in details, which is also the original appearance of the long river of time.
In this case, the fate of being framed will cause changes in the long river of time.
And it's continuous.
Without locking fate, the power that can be drawn each time is unstable and the number of times is small.
Locking fate, the power that can be drawn each time is not much, but the number of times is extremely frequent.
As long as no "lock" is broken, then the power of this world will continue to grow
So, how should we maintain this world?
Art stared into the distance. He had thought before that the world would be closely monitored.
Moreover, it is impossible for a regular state or other powerhouses with multiple levels of strength to be at the mercy of the game kingdom.
Then
Give part of the income from the stable operation of the world to the gods of this world?
It turned out to be the case.
Art quickly determined a conclusion that best fit his guess from several logical conclusions.
The gods of this world also have the duty of monitoring and maintaining this world.
Then
Perhaps there are one or more gods who control "fate" and walk the path of "fate"?
If this is indeed the case, then maybe I have some opportunities?
Although he already knew that his "conceptual state" was not perfect, it was not difficult in theory to manipulate a "doom" god in a regular state.
But a theory is a theory, and his minimum goal is—
"no injury"
Others might accept success at a price, but not Arter.
Not because of his persecutory paranoia-like hyper-cautiousness, but reality.
If he doesn't complete his actions against the gods related to fate in a short time or if there are some traps, the information about his ability related to fate or those who have such abilities among the "players" will be leaked immediately.
Although the theory is good, it is ideal in practice. If something goes wrong and the information on his existence is leaked, the loss outweighs the gain.
However, at this moment, something happened to the team of 30 people he was paying attention to.
A gigantic beast abruptly lifted the ground, crawled out from under the snow that had not completely melted, and swung its giant claws at the group of people amidst a roar full of hatred.
(End of this chapter)
